What is Cryotherapy and How Does it Work?
Cryotherapy, derived from the Greek word "kryos" meaning cold, is a revolutionary treatment that exposes the body to extremely low temperatures for short durations. This process triggers a natural response that enhances blood circulation, reduces inflammation, and promotes faster recovery. When you undergo cryotherapy, your body reacts to the cold by sending blood to your core to maintain internal temperature. Once you exit the chamber, oxygenated blood flows back to your extremities, revitalizing tissues and muscles.
This therapy is particularly effective for athletes and individuals recovering from injuries. The anti-inflammatory properties of cryotherapy help reduce swelling and pain, allowing for quicker rehabilitation. Additionally, cryotherapy has been linked to improved mental health by releasing endorphins, which elevate mood and reduce stress. Is Cryotherapy Safe? What Are the Risks?
While cryotherapy is generally considered safe, understanding potential risks is crucial. Proper supervision and adherence to safety protocols ensure a secure experience. Common side effects include temporary skin redness, numbness, or tingling, which typically resolve quickly after treatment. However, individuals with certain medical conditions, such as Raynaud's disease or severe hypertension, should consult a healthcare provider before undergoing cryotherapy.

What Should You Expect During Your First Cryotherapy Session in Pasadena?
Your first cryotherapy session in Pasadena will begin with a consultation to discuss your goals and health history. This ensures the treatment is tailored to your specific needs. During the session, you'll enter a cryochamber where temperatures can reach as low as -250°F (-157°C) for a few minutes. The cold exposure is tolerable due to the dry air, and most clients describe the sensation as refreshing rather than uncomfortable.
After the session, you may experience immediate benefits such as reduced pain and increased energy. Regular treatments can lead to more profound improvements in overall health and well-being. What Are the Costs Associated with Cryotherapy Pasadena?
The cost of cryotherapy in Pasadena varies depending on factors such as session frequency, package deals, and individual clinic pricing. On average, single sessions range from $40 to $80, with discounts available for purchasing multiple sessions. Many clinics offer membership options that provide ongoing access to treatments at reduced rates.

Is Cryotherapy Covered by Insurance?
Whether cryotherapy is covered by insurance depends on your specific policy and the reason for treatment. Some health insurance plans may cover cryotherapy when prescribed for medical conditions such as chronic pain or inflammation. However, cosmetic or general wellness applications typically aren't included in coverage. Always verify with your insurance provider to understand what's covered under your plan.
